Output cac63f1f1b78893c4836f5846b8acd752428c12b33b8b67adeed8d8e3049343e:3

value
361481629
script pubkey
OP_0 OP_PUSHBYTES_20 a672c820c49a2e704e2a6f06b6106265f76a22be
address
bc1q5eevsgxyngh8qn32durtvyrzvhmk5g47kpdyf9
transaction
cac63f1f1b78893c4836f5846b8acd752428c12b33b8b67adeed8d8e3049343e
confirmations
317372
spent
true